Ten years ago today, I received a phone call that would change my life forever. My parents called to tell me that my brother had passed away. Less than a week prior, the four of us had spent an amazing Christmas holiday together in San Francisco. He was strong as an ox, happy and healthy. Within a couple days of him returning home to Seattle, he caught a really bad flu bug. He was meant to go to the doctor on Monday, yet passed away that weekend in his sleep. He had gone into a diabetic coma and didnt wake up. I didnt know he had caught the flu. For me, this was the most saddening news and devastating event of my life. I trusted that my big brother was a permanent fixture, non negotiable for all my days on this planet. Many of you in here had the chance to know Jeff and it makes me happy to know that he lives on in your memories and close to your hearts. He was one of the best human beings Ive known, most definitely cut from a premium cloth.... Of course, the apple didnt far fall from the Dan & Diane tree! He was self-LESS and Joy-FULL, lived every day to the fullest, an ambitious dreamer with the best of intentions to make the world a kinder and more loving place. Over these last ten years, the grief has softened and my life keeps getting exponentially better and better. Thank god when grief carves out such deep space that eventually theres an opportunity to fill it back up with MORE love & joy than previously imagined possible! Quite possibly, one of my longest posts here and Ill end by saying... Jeff, we miss you and love you more than words can say. Thanks for ALL the great memories. XO
